Iran’s Islamic Revolution Guards Corps (IRGC) says it stands ready alongside the Army to deliver a “regret-inducing” response to the US and Israeli regime if they renew their criminal act of aggression against the country.

 

The IRGC made the announcement in a statement released on Friday to mark National Army Day.

 

“The Islamic Republic of Iran Army and the IRGC [using] weapons of unity, integrity, coordination, synergy, empathy, and sacred will … stand ready amid a lull in the battlefield during the third imposed war, with their hand on the trigger to deliver a powerful, destructive and regret-inducing response to any aggressive and criminal act by the American-Zionist enemy and their companions against Iran and its history-making nation,” it said.

 

Iran has witnessed three imposed wars over the past years, including the 1980s’ Iraq war, and two US-Israeli illegal acts of aggression, namely the 12-day one in June 2025 and this year’s 40-day one.

Also in its statement, the IRGC said that the Army - relying on its revolutionary spirit, experience during the eight-year Iraqi-imposed war, and indigenous knowledge and technology - has solidified its place in the country's defense architecture over the past 47 years and turned into a strong fortress of the nation.

 

It further hailed the Army’s brilliant and honorable role in defending Iran's independence, security, and territorial integrity.

 

The combat readiness of the Army and the IRGC ground forces foiled the enemy’s plot to launch a ground and naval incursion into Iran and shattered its dream of occupying Iranian islands in the Persian Gulf, noted the IRGC.

 

It also warned that any foolish act on the part of the enemy will bring about nothing but humiliation and a strategic defeat.

Meanwhile, it stressed that the efficiency of the Army and other armed forces in defending the country against the terrorist US-Israeli aggression was the outcome of guidelines issued by Leader of the Islamic Revolution Ayatollah Seyyed Mojtaba Khamenei and military commanders.

 

The recent US-Israeli aggression on Iran began on February 28 with airstrikes that assassinated senior Iranian officials and commanders.

 

The Iranian armed forces unleashed 100 waves of successful retaliatory strikes against sensitive and strategic American and Israeli targets throughout the region.

 

Forty days into the war, a Pakistan-brokered two-week ceasefire went into effect but Washington-Tehran negotiations failed to reach a deal.
